Ritual Tides Mixes Amnesia With Survival Horror Shooting and Occult Creatures

With the various horror games out there, especially upcoming efforts like Silent Hill: Townfall, it’s always interesting to see titles like Ritual Tides with their own signature brand of weirdness. The premise sounds familiar – washed up on an island with no memories, and becoming embroiled in things clearly outside of your pay grade. Still, there’s a genuine creepiness hard to deny, especially in the latest trailer.

After meeting Malcolm, you’re told that the locals worship Mother Hortus, and if that wasn’t strange enough, there are “creatures” roaming about. The island’s remote location cuts off any escape, but you still need to try, even as Hortus’s cult – and whatever that thing is that’s consuming bodies whole – attempts to stop you.

Developed by Vertpaint, which is comprised of “industry veterans,” Ritual Tides leans into more realistic gameplay rather than having you LARP as Leon S. Kennedy. Besides making ammo scarce, you also need to use each hand to climb and carefully balance when walking on planks. As the team notes on Steam, “a gun is not always reliable,” so it’s best to choose your moments.

Visually, Ritual Tides – which is coming to PC and consoles but doesn’t have a release date – looks solid, courtesy of photogrammetry scans done by the team. We’ll be keeping a close eye on its development, so stay tuned for more updates.
